Majora's Mask plays very similar to Ocarina of Time, since many aspects of the first game on the Nintendo 64 were brought to the second. However, Majora's Mask has a unique cycle of 3 days, in which the player has to travel back in time at the end right before the moon crashes into Termina. As soon as the player travels back in time, they lose certain items and progress they made during the last 3 days. Because of the 3 day mechanic, Majora's Mask is more time travel heavy than Ocarina of Time. In Ocarina of Time, the only time travel is between the future and the past, while in Majora's Mask, you can go back to the beginning of the 3 days, slow down time, and fast forward to any point in the 3 day cycle.

Majora's Mask is also strange because the main quest is rather short. This is compensated however with the abundance of side quests found in the game. Many of these side quests reward Link with various kinds of masks. If Link obtains all the Masks in the game, he is rewarded with the most powerful one in the game right before the final battle. Because of the power of the final mask, the final boss can either be the easiest or one of the most difficult in the Zelda series.
